Presenting : Career Self Management Process

For the past 10 years, RIST has accompanied Researchers and Experts in multinational companies and public research institutions with the Career & Expertise: Better Guidance© (CSMP©) program.  Thanks to this experience, RIST has matured this unique method to accompany them in their chosen career path.

CSMP© 1 enables the researcher and/or expert with 3 to 8 years of experience to understand their environment better and to identify the elements to take into account when making choices for their career path or expertise development.   

CSMP© 2 is aimed at Researchers and Experts with more than 15 years of experience, who work in the world of scientific research and wonder about their compatibility with their environment, their mode of functioning professionally, and their future.

CSMP© 1

  CSMP© 1, an ideal opportunity in your life to

  • Become aware of how you function
  • Expand your understanding of your professional environment and the mechanisms of your functioning 
  • Define the vision of your career as a researcher and/or expert
  • Build strategies to consolidate and expand your expertise
  • Develop your independence and your capacity to make choices in the management of your career and your skills.

  How CSMP© 1 unfolds (over approximately 2 months in total)

  1. First interview (2h30) : Get an overview and clarify your way of devising, deciding on and implementing your personnal trajectory.
  2. First individual period : Integrate the content of the first interview with the help of the Heuristic 1 tool developed by RIST (3 hours of individual work on average).
  3. Second interview (1h) : Debrief and work on the field of possibilities and risk management.
  4. Second individual period : Reflect on your career based on the science and expertise version of Heuristic 2 tool (3 hours of individual work on average).
  5.  Third interview : Build the next stage according to your own « equation » and environment

 

CSMP© 2

CSMP© 2, an ideal opportunity in one’s professional life to

  • Take stock and get an overview
  • Reconnect with what excites you professionally
  • Become aware of your mode of working in relation to your environment (family, social, professional)
  • Confirm your professional trajectory or reposition it in relation to your own “equation” and its context.

How CSMP© 2 unfolds (over approximately 2 months in total)

  1. First interview (2h30) : Examine your career history in order to identify how you devise, decide on and live out your personal trajectory.
  2. First individual period : Integrate the content of the first interview with the help of the Heuristic 1 tool developed by RIST (3 hours of individual work on average).
  3. Second interview (1h) : Work on the suitability of your positioning, the field of possibilities, risk management, and coherence.
  4. Second individual period :  Reflect on the continuance of your pathway based on the science and expertise version of the Heuristic 2 tool (3 hours of individual work on average).
  5. Third interview (1h) : Define the level of engagement for the next stage according to your own “equation” and its context.

  

The Special Features of RIST

In-depth knowledge of the problems of Researchers and Experts, and the tools developed by RIST to respond to them:  typology of risks in scientific and expertise careers; typology of research careers; dynamic list of possible roles and behaviors; analysis of the development of scientific and/or expertise skills; analysis of the key points in a career; individual scientific roadmap; and development of scientific networks.

A structured and innovative methodology: an awareness of the dynamics of skills, obsolescence and human environments; the importance given to the role of the individual and the skills they apply to develop in their environment; work on the field of possibilities, risks and coherence; 10 years of development of RIST Lab in partnership with Dauphine and Mines Paris Tech, and of application in multinationals and public research institutions.

An approach that is respectful of the individual, that favors understanding based on their personal life story and emotional history, and that seeks to understand everyone’s unique “equation”. A comprehensive approach where the company/research institution is not necessarily the center of the individual’s life.
